Transaction 5a65a99ea5ee274864fadc63068b353d52acd4f7c6de5944a321d3598753248e
1 Input
1 Output
-
5a65a99ea5ee274864fadc63068b353d52acd4f7c6de5944a321d3598753248e:0
- value
- 2389142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b972f3912fccb672adc50374d08ff49b270c1bda OP_EQUAL
- address
- 3JbadzqgGF9fePzWShq8jZAhdEHhMgEX4b